Latest Patents
Kleckowski holds a patent for a Fiber Optic Pulling Grip Assembly. This invention includes a sleeve unit that sleeves around a cable section of a fiber optic cable and a guiding unit. The sleeve unit consists of a sleeve member, an insertion tube received in a receiving space extending along the sleeve member, and a blocking member connected to the sleeve member. The guiding unit features a fixing ring disposed between an optical fiber section and a mesh of the fiber optic cable, a rear portion connected to the sleeve member to clamp a rear end of the mesh, a front portion defining a channel for the passage of the optical fiber section and the mesh, a connecting member linked to the optical fiber section, and a pulling member connected to the front portion to clamp a front end of the mesh.
